I have 50 sheets called run1 ... run50
In G1 of each sheat I have a number (number of rows G4:Gn, in that sheet) I want to bring the valuse of G1 from all 50 sheets to another sheet (summary Shheet). Is it possible to do it by "indirect" command to copy the (run3!G$1$) reference cell? I couldn't succeed. -- Rasoul Khoshravan Azar Civil Engineer Osaka, Japan |

On reflection, I think you probably want 50 different values, so you
can make use of the ROW( ) function to give you the increment for your "run" sheets. Assuming you have some description in column A, and that your first formula is in row 3 (to allow for headings etc), then enter this in B3: =INDIRECT("'run"&(ROW()-2)&"'!G$1") and copy down for 50 rows. You want the expression in the middle to evaluate to 1 for your first row, so if this is on row 5 then change it to: (ROW()-4) The apostrophes are not strictly necessary if you do not have spaces in the sheet names. Hope this helps. Pete |
